Hyper-Personalization or Surveillance? The New Era of AI Advertising | Fortune AI Playbook
Why It Matters
AI coding agents promise faster, cheaper development but introduce security and oversight challenges that could reshape software teams and risk corporate data integrity.
Key Takeaways
- •AI coding agents can generate entire programs from plain English prompts
- •Developers shift from writing code to supervising AI-generated outputs
- •Lowered entry barriers enable non‑technical staff to create software
- •AI‑written code risks hidden security flaws and technical debt
- •“Slob squatting” exploits AI library imports to inject malware
Summary
The video spotlights the rapid rise of AI coding agents—models that translate natural‑language instructions into functional software. Companies like Google and JPMorgan already rely on these tools, prompting a fundamental redefinition of the developer’s role from line‑by‑line author to high‑level overseer.
Key points include three strategic shifts: developers now focus on specifying features and validating outputs; the technical barrier to building applications drops dramatically, allowing non‑engineers to prototype code; and new risk vectors emerge, such as hidden security vulnerabilities, accumulated technical debt, and AI hallucinations that fabricate libraries or tests. A particularly alarming scenario, dubbed “slob squatting,” involves malicious actors registering libraries that AI agents are likely to import, thereby injecting malware into corporate networks.
The speaker cites internal practices at OpenAI and Anthropic, where engineers have gone months without hand‑writing a single line, instead supervising AI‑generated code. He also highlights real‑world examples of AI‑produced code that appears clean but contains brittle constructs, and recounts how a bad actor leveraged slob squatting to compromise a system.
For businesses, the message is clear: while AI coding agents can accelerate development and democratize software creation, they also demand rigorous oversight, robust security testing, and a re‑skilling strategy for developers. The broader implication is a near‑term transformation of software engineering, but a longer horizon before similar automation reshapes other knowledge‑intensive professions.
Comments
Want to join the conversation?
Loading comments...